1/17/06 -Long Island University head coach Toby Rens has announced the signing of two student-athletes to join the volleyball program in the fall. Martina Racic and Toni Perhat have signed National Letters of Intent to represent the two-time Northeast Conference champions.

Racic, a 6-2 middle blocker, hails from Pula, Croatia. She competed on the Pula Club team and earned all-area and Junior National Team honors for the past two seasons.

“Martina is a very talented player who works hard both on and off the court. She is extremely quick and will have an immediate impact on the team,” Rens notes. “We're looking forward to Martina continuing her education and playing career as a Blackbird."

Perhat, also from Croatia, is a 6-0 left-handed opposite hitter from Manatee (Fla.) Community College. She finished fourth in the Florida Community College Activities Association (FCCAA) with 9.2 assists per game and fifth in digs with 4.7 recorded a game.

“Toni brings a lot of experience and athleticism,” Rens says of the southpaw. “We’re looking forward to the impact that she is going to have on our program. Toni is the ideal student-athlete; focused and will fit in well with our team philosophy.”

The Blackbirds claimed their second consecutive NEC crown this past fall. They advanced to the second round of the 2005 NCAA Volleyball Championships, becoming the first league team to win a match in NCAA play.
